"Bu Piao spent half his life and ended up like this!"
He died before his success was fulfilled, and his passion was in vain.
The former body of Baimenlou died, but his heroic spirit drifted to the water margin.
Lu Bu was reborn as Xiao Wenhou Lu Fang!
After finally waking up, he changed his mind and determined to dominate the world. However, Lu Bu suddenly found out why Cao Liusun was here too? !
Well, others beat 108 generals in Water Margin, Lu Bu beat Cao Liusun in Water Margin!
Let's put an end to the grievances of the late Han Dynasty in Water Margin!
Everyone in the world must know that in troubled times, one can look to Lu Bu to be powerful; to be majestic and heroic, look to Red Rabbit!
